One of the most significant advantages of Carbon Hybrid Composite Pipes is their exceptional strength-to-weight ratio. Unlike conventional pipes made of steel or plastic, these composite pipes are lighter yet significantly stronger. This means that projects requiring long transport distances or elevated installations can benefit from reduced structural stress and easier handling, resulting in lower overall project costs.
Traditional metal pipes often fall victim to corrosion, leading to increased maintenance costs and replacements. Carbon Hybrid Composite Pipes are resistant to various corrosive environments, making them ideal for industries dealing with chemicals, saltwater, and other harsh substances. This durability ensures a longer lifespan and reduced need for frequent replacement, which pays off in the long run.
The innovative construction of Carbon Hybrid Composite Pipes offers superior thermal insulation properties. This quality helps maintain the desired temperature of fluids inside the pipes, reducing energy costs and increasing system efficiency. Environments that require consistent heat retention can greatly benefit from this feature, allowing for effective energy management.

As sustainability becomes a pressing concern in various industries, Carbon Hybrid Composite Pipes stand out with their lower environmental impact. The production processes involve fewer resources and generate less waste compared to traditional piping materials. Furthermore, their longevity means less frequent replacements, leading to a decrease in manufacturing and disposal footprints. This aligns with corporate social responsibility goals and can even enhance a company's brand reputation.
Carbon Hybrid Composite Pipes can be engineered to meet specific design requirements, offering flexibility that traditional materials often lack. Their customization allows for innovative shapes, sizes, and attributes that cater to unique project needs. This versatility makes them suitable across various sectors, including construction, automotive, and aerospace.
